Researchers Design Facial Recognition System as a Less Invasive Approach to Tracking Lemurs in the Wild

A team of researchers has developed a new computer-assisted recognition system that can identify individual lemurs in the wild by their facial characteristics and ultimately help to build a database for long-term research on lemur species. The scientists hope this method has the potential to redefine how researchers track endangered species in the wild.

Printable solar cells just got a little closer

A U of T Engineering innovation could make building printing cells as easy and inexpensive as printing a newspaper. Dr. Hairen Tan and his team have cleared a critical manufacturing hurdle in the development of a relatively new class of solar devices called perovskite solar cells. This alternative solar technology could lead to low-cost, printable solar panels capable of turning nearly any surface into a power generator.

Real-Time MRI Analysis Powered by Supercomputers

One of the main tools doctors use to detect diseases and injuries in cases ranging from multiple sclerosis to broken bones is magnetic resonance imaging (MRI). However, the results of an MRI scan take hours or days to interpret and analyze. This means that if a more detailed investigation is needed, or there is a problem with the scan, the patient needs to return for a follow-up.

Study links outdoor air pollution with millions of preterm births

The study, which was led by a team from The Stockholm Environment Institute (SEI) at the University of York, found that in 2010, about 2.7 million preterm births globally – or 18% of all pre-term births – were associated with outdoor exposure to fine particulate matter.

Less snow and a shorter ski season in the Alps

After long-awaited snowfall in January, parts of the Alps are now covered with fresh powder and happy skiers. But the Swiss side of the iconic mountain range had the driest December since record-keeping began over 150 years ago, and 2016 was the third year in a row with scarce snow over the Christmas period. A study published today in The Cryosphere, a journal of the European Geosciences Union, shows bare Alpine slopes could be a much more common sight in the future.
